This piece deserves it's own page. My good friend Ricki Stitzer faceted this Brazilian Fire Opal. This is the largest faceted fire opal I have seen. I set a concave cut lemon quartz at the top to maintain the fire color scheme. By far the nicest piece of jewelry I have ever made.
